Output bb593e7959a3a60ba6eb6155e4f69e82617237861194a1a5e7b5496d5c9bb063:0

value
516289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880a4e84ccf6156b681d9d21c429b2f1ddfa16fa OP_EQUAL
address
3E6LAknWmvDAaxtpttnfyFSt1Me6aUgBFx
transaction
bb593e7959a3a60ba6eb6155e4f69e82617237861194a1a5e7b5496d5c9bb063
spent
true